Are you looking for an exciting opportunity, working within an established team?

At Age UK Leeds we are passionate about providing an excellent Advice and Information Services to people aged 50+. We offer free, impartial holistic advice on a wide range of issues; including money matters, applying for benefits (pension age), social care, aids and adaptations and consumer issues and energy switching.

We are now recruiting for an Advice Support Officer to assist the Operations Manager and Advice Staff to ensure the effective and efficient operation of the Age UK Leeds Advice service.

This role will also work alongside the Receptionist and other administrative roles in the wider team, providing essential reception and support service at our city centre office.

This role has a varied job description and will allow the successful candidate to showcase a wide range of administrative, IT and communication skills.

Please note ability to use Microsoft programmes to a high standard is essential for this role, in particular Word and Excel.

The post is part time (up to 28 hours per week) but will be required to work Fridays.

We may consider recruiting two candidates for this role, totalling up to 28 hours per week, to ensure we meet the requirements of the service.
